Frequently asked questions about second in french pay in Newport (county)

How much does a second in french earn in Newport (county)?

The average salary for a second in french in Newport (county) is £47,000 per year, typically ranging from £38,540 per year to £57,340 per year depending on experience, phase and school type.

Is Newport (county) a well-paid area for second in frenchs?

Newport (county) tends to sit around 6% below the UK average for second in frenchs. Regional demand, cost of living and school funding all play a part.

How can a second in french in Newport (county) increase their salary?

Second in Frenchs in Newport (county) typically increase pay by moving up MPS/UPS + TLR where applicable, taking on TLR or leadership responsibility, gaining specialist qualifications, or relocating to a higher-paying region such as London.

What's the difference between second in french pay in Newport (county) and nationally?

Nationally the average is £50,000 per year. In Newport (county) it's £47,000 per year — a discount of £3,000 per year versus the UK average.
